#df9600 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#df9600 is composed of 87.5% red, 58.8%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.7% magenta, 100%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 40.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 43.7%. #df9600 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ff00 with #bf2d00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

● #df9600 color description : Pure (or mostly pure) orange.
#df9600 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#df9600 has RGB values of R:223, G:150,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:1,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 14652928.
